From fbdf7929b87f3e41b0ff573b8eaae44cdfae16d9 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Hans Bolinder Date: Thu, 1 Mar 2012 11:48:20 +0100 Subject: Remove loops from the graph created by digraph_utils:condensation/1 The function digraph_utils:condensation/1 used to create a digraph containing loops contradicting the documentation which states that the created digraph is free of cycles.
